Understanding VoIP Phone Systems
What Is VoIP?
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) refers to a technology that allows voice communication to be transmitted over the internet instead of traditional telephone lines. This technological shift has transformed how businesses communicate internally and externally.
How Do VoIP Phone Systems Work?
VoIP phone systems convert voice signals into digital data packets and transmit them over the internet. This process enables users to make calls using broadband connections instead of relying on conventional phone networks.
Key Components of VoIP Systems
Internet Connection: A stable broadband connection is essential for seamless communication. VoIP Phones: These can be specialized hardware or standard phones connected via adapters. VoIP Service Provider: Companies must partner with a reliable provider to access VoIP services. Network Equipment: Routers and switches that manage data traffic ensure quality service.Benefits of VoIP Phone Systems
Cost Savings
One of the most compelling reasons businesses opt for VoIP phone systems is cost efficiency. Traditional phone lines often come with high fees for long-distance calls and installation charges. In contrast, VoIP significantly reduces these costs through:
- Lower call rates Elimination of expensive hardware Reduced maintenance fees
Scalability and Flexibility
As businesses grow or change, so do their communication needs. VoIP phone systems offer unparalleled scalability, allowing companies to easily add or remove lines without incurring substantial costs or delays.
Enhanced Features
Gone are the days when basic calling functionality sufficed! Modern VoIP phone systems come loaded with features such as:
- Call forwarding Voicemail-to-email Video conferencing Integration with Customer Relationship Management (CRM) platforms
These features enhance productivity and streamline collaboration within teams.

Security Considerations for VoIP Systems
Understanding Vulnerabilities
While VoIP phone systems offer numerous advantages, they aren’t immune to security threats such as hacking and eavesdropping.
Implementing Security Measures
To protect your communications:
Use encrypted connections. Regularly update software. Train employees on security best practices.Choosing the Right VoIP Provider
